A prominent Opposition politico created a stir in military circles recently, when he tried to forcibly enter an Army base in the North.
The politico had claimed that he had a right to enter an Army camp given his official status in the Opposition. However, Army authorities had refused him access to the camp as he had failed to obtain due permission in advance.
The Army authorities had reported this incident to Police. However, Police have called off further action on the matter on instructions from a high Police authority, they say.
